网站建设资讯

NEWS

网站建设资讯

封装jquery插件 jquery封装的函数

如何理解Jquery插件

1、基础版jQuery插件知道了上面这些知识,我们就可以来写一个简单的jQuery插件。

网站建设哪家好,找创新互联!专注于网页设计、网站建设、微信开发、小程序开发、集团企业网站建设等服务项目。为回馈新老客户创新互联还提供了围场免费建站欢迎大家使用!

2、良好的兼容性:jQuery插件可以在大多数现代浏览器中使用,并且可以与jQuery一起使用,不会出现冲突。强大的功能:jQuery插件通常具有丰富的功能,例如动画、过滤器、DOM操作、事件处理等。

3、实现交互交互是一组插件,便于用户与DOM元素交互。

4、DataTables是一个jQuery的表格插件。实例讲解需求:如下图所示,对datatables的内容进行添加,编辑,删除的操作。分析:添加功能---单击add按钮,弹出对话框,添加新的内容。

如何编写jquery插件

1、类级别的插件开发最直接的理解就是给jQuery类添加类方法,可以理解为添加静态方法。典型的例子就是$.AJAX()这个函数,将函数定义于jQuery的命名空间中。

2、通过$.extend()来扩展jQuery 通过$.fn 向jQuery添加新的方法 通过$.widget()应用jQuery UI的部件工厂方式创建 第一种$.extend()相对简单,一般很少能够独立开发复杂插件,第三种是一种高级的开发模式,本文也不做介绍。

3、JavaScript prototype 属性的一个 jQuery 别名。要使用 fn 属性创建一个新 jQuery 插件,只需要为 fn 属性分配一个插件名,并将其指向一个充当构造函数的新函数,类似于纯 JavaScript。

4、jquery插件有两种,一种是$(.xxx).xxx(); 另一种是$.xxx();自定义jquery插件,我理解是插件的写法啦。

jquery封装插件的时候,如何合并参数列表,类似$.extend({},a,b...

var newSrc=$.extend({},src1,src2,src..)//也就是将{}作为dest参数。这样就可以将src1,src2,src..进行合并,然后将合并结果返回给newSrc了。

limit: 5, name: bar } empty == { validate: true, limit: 5, name: bar }这个重载的方法,我们一般用来在编写插件时用自定义插件参数去覆盖插件的默认参数。

jQuery为开发插件提拱了两个方法,分别是:jQuery.fn.extend();jQuery.extend();虽然 javascript 没有明确的类的概念,但是用类来理解它,会更方便。


网站栏目:封装jquery插件 jquery封装的函数
URL分享:http://njwzjz.com/article/dgjjhhd.html